14 Dean Street, Huddersfield, HD3 3EU is a freehold terraced property built between 1900-1929. The property offers approximately 646 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have two b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£144,444 , which equates to approximately £224 per square foot. It was last sold on 1 Jun 2018 for £100,000. Since then, the value has increased by £44,444, representing a 44.4% increase, or approximately 5.9% per year.

The current estimated value of £144,444 is:

  • 1.9% higher than the average property price on Dean Street
  • 5.2% higher than the average in the HD3 3EU postcode area
  • and 35.9% lower than the average price for Huddersfield as a whole

Based on EPC inspection history, this property has been mostly owner-occupied (2 out of 3 inspections). This suggests the property has typically been lived in by its owners, which often reflects longer-term residency and more consistent maintenance.

At the most recent EPC inspection on 12 June 2025, the property was recorded as rented.

EPC Summary

14 Dean Street, Huddersfield, Kirklees, West Yorkshire, HD3 3EU has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of D, based on the latest assessment carried out on 12 Jun 2025.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 15 Apr 2016. The rating of D remains the same, but the energy efficiency score improved by 6.8%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, 150 mm loft insulation to pitched, 200 mm loft insulation, with no change in energy efficiency (good).
  • The lighting was changed from low energy lighting in 88% of fixed outlets to low energy lighting in all fixed outlets, with no change in efficiency (very good).
